"Crushed"
[The Witch-Game Series, Book 1] by Kasi Blake (aka K. C. Blake)

Author's Book Description :
    The Noah girls have beauty, powers, and brains.

    They use all three to play their games.

    They blow the dust,

    the boys are crushed,

    and no one is ever the same.

    Each year the Noah girls play a secret game— Crushed. The rules are simple.


    1. Use wisdom to pick your target. The boy can’t be too weak or too strong-willed.

    2. Blow the enchanted dust into your target’s face to enchant (Crush) him.

    3. Give verbal commands and assign them tasks to perform throughout the year. The more tasks completed, the stronger the witch’s power grows.

    4. At the end of the year, the witch with the most power wins cold, hard cash.

    As if being a witch in high school isn’t complicated enough, Kristen picks the wrong boy to Crush. Zach is tall, handsome, and a little scary. Her Crush spell isn’t working on him like it has with the others. In fact, he is behaving the opposite of every other boy she’s Crushed, hating her instead of adoring her. Something is definitely wrong. After someone attempts to kill her, Kristen realizes there is more at risk than a few hundred dollars. She may be betting with her life.

About the Author :

When Kasi Blake was in the third grade, she found out that a good story could get her out of trouble. Okay, some people call it a lie, but she didn't see anything wrong with using every skill available to her to avoid being grounded. Over the years, that didn't change. Her stories just grew more elaborate. When she was 12, she began to write them down, starting with a six-page tale about a boy from the wrong side of the tracks and the good girl that secretly wanted him. Kasi went on to write for Harlequin for a few years. Then, she published a vampire series on her own, and now she is publishing with Clean Teen.

Get ready for an exciting series on witches using their powers to play dangerous games at school. The first is "Crushed." You can find her on Twitter @kasiblake, on FB, and she has a website under her name.

Kasi lives on a farm in the Midwest with tons of animals including cows, ducks, chickens, a dog, and cats.

"Dragon's Redemption" [Dragon Lore Series, Book 2] by Eden Ashe

Author's Book Description : The one female he isn't supposed to want, is the only one he's ever needed.

When her brother goes missing, everything in Lily Cage’s world turns upside down. Born a Hunter female, the last thing she needs is an attraction to Dallas, the scariest dragon in existence. The one known as The Destroyer. With peace between the Hunters and Dragons hanging by a thread, one wrong move on Lily or Dallas’s part could catapult them all back into war. But with Dallas playing by his own rules and someone on the outside decimating her life, they have a choice–stand and fight, or lose everything they never realized they wanted.

My Book Review : 3.5 out of 5 stars! About a thousand years ago, Dallas (The Destroyer) lost his family and potential mate to a hunter wiping them out. Now, at his King’s wedding, he meets a hunter who will change his life forever by making him wish for more. Yet, is he willing to sacrifice everything for this little hunter?

Intense and dramatic, this intriguing novel keeps its readers gripped in suspense until the very end! While I loved Dallas, Lily, and their developing relationship I had a hard time following the secondary plot, probably because this was the first novel in this series that I’d read. However, even with the confusion and at times feeling like the secondary plot dragged a bit, I absolutely could NOT get enough of Dallas and Lily! Together they made a dynamic duo who fit each other perfectly. I’d love to read more about them as this series continues.

I recommend this novel to those looking for a highly suspenseful, slightly erotic, paranormal dragon romance!!

My Book Review : 2 out of 5 stars. Going into her senior year of high school, Kristen is optimistic that this year will be great. However, from the first day things go from okay to terrible…
  • Her nemesis, Gina, calls her out in front of everyone.
  • Her sister bets her to “crush” Zach, one of the hottest/scariest boys in school, which leads to another rivalry unintended between her and her sister.
  • Now she has to deal with a Zach, who isn’t acting like a “crushed guy” should and instead of falling for her, he seems to hate her even more. Except for those rare occasions when he’s charming her…
From that day on life as Kristen knows it will never be the same. But will it be all for the best or will things just keep getting worse?

Wowza goes the drama! Suspenseful from beginning to end, this novel keeps its readers on their toes. It’s about witch/wizard families and what they’ll do for one another. While this dynamic cast is quiet entertaining, they also overload this novel with so much drama that if you don’t appreciate it then it’ll drag the readers down. That is actually what happened to me, it had too much drama for me to really like it. Nevertheless, Kristen, Zach, and their siblings create enough havoc in each other’s lives that if you are typically interested in dramatically suspenseful YA paranormal novels, that have a few romantic scenes included, then this might be more suited to you then me.

This wasn’t my type of novel. Yet, as I stated above this is for those who like suspenseful paranormal YA novels.
